Hypnosis, unless you've experienced it at the hands of a good therapist (rather than an entertainer), is a subject most people know very little about. But it's a subject you're bound to know someone who thinks they know all about.
For the majority hypnosis is associated with stage shows, after that it helps people to stop smoking and after that it helps people to lose weight and after that they use it in past-life regression and after that there isn't any after that. But this article isn't about what hypnosis can and can't do; it is about the availability of treatment and the format that treatment can take.
In a one-to-one session you get to:
* have personal attention
* ask questions
* have a session that can be changed dynamically depending upon your responses
* effective treatment
* deal with unusual problems that CD's don't normally cover
* know that you are safe because you have a professional watching you
with a CD you get to:
* enjoy low-cost treatment
* listen to a session as often as you like
* have much more practice at entering trance (you go deeper the more you do it)
* enjoy treatment at a time and place that suits you
* portable treatment
* effective treatment
* feel safe because you are in a place of your own choosing where you feel secure
* experience hypnosis if you just want to see what it's like and if it works for you.
Like the beans, or the hi-fi, what's best is what's best for you. And what's best for you depends in part upon what you want. If you want to go and see someone and it's important for you to have someone listen to your story and give you personal advice and help and guide you step-by-step back to wholeness, and cost isn't a consideration then a one-to-one with a qualified hypnotherapist is what's best for you.
If you don't like talking about your problems; or you feel uncomfortable about the idea of choosing a therapist from Yellow Pages; if cost is a consideration, if the problem you want help with is a problem for which CD's are readily available then buying a CD and listening to it until you feel better is what's best for you.
One isn't better than the other. They are different. Both effective. Both with advantages.
At the end of the day what matters is that you make the right choice for you, even if that's a CD for weight loss, and a one-to-one for a phobia cure. The right choice for you is the one that makes you feel pleased that you spent the money because you feel good about the results, feel good about the choice you made, and feel good about encouraging others with the same problem to do what you did.
